Program 35 – Station Class of Service

LED 17: Continuous DTMF Tones Off

2000-series digital telephones can send DTMF tones for as long as station users press their buttons (80 msec. minimum). This feature can be disabled (LED 17 On). If it is disabled, DTMF tones sent by these telephones will be either 80 or 160 milliseconds depending on the selection made with Program 10-1, LED 04 and Program 10-2, LED 06.

Note PDKU1 does not support continuous DTMF tones on 2000-series digital telephones.

LED 16: No Call Forward/No Answer on Handsfree Answerback

When enabled (LED 16 On), a Handsfree Answerback call to an idle station in the Call Forward No-Answer or Call Forward-Busy/No Answer mode is not forwarded. If the system is Programmed for Voice first (Program 10-1 and 10-2, LED 01 Off), Voice Announce calls do not Call Forward No-Answer; however, calls will call forward busy. This prevents the call from being forwarded 8-60 seconds after the called party has been talking in the Handsfree Answerback mode.

Outside calls and busy internal calls to the station continue to forward with this feature set. If the system is set for Tone First, calls will call forward on Busy and No Answer.

Notes

The caller can press the RING Soft Key on digital LCD telephones or press ￿ on digital or electronic telephones to activate Call Forward on Voice Announce calls.

OCA calls do not Call Forward No Answer in any case.

LED 15: ISDN Immediate DIaling

ISDN Immediate Dialing Without Subaddress enables the system to send out the SETUP message to an ISDN line without waiting for the user to press the Start button and without waiting for the time span between digits to time out. If LED 15 is On, ISDN Immediate Dialing is valid. If LED 15 is Off, the feature is Off (default).

ISDN Immediate Dialing is available for PRI calls on POTS, FX, OUTWATS and BRI POTS calls. It is unavailable for senderized and cut-through calls on Tie lines, since the Tie lines are provided for exclusive use. Immediate Dialing is not applicable for INWATS lines, since this service line is for incoming calls only.

Since the ISDN Immediate Dialing begins as soon as the dialed number is confirmed as valid per the NANP table below. ISDN subaddress dialing will be unavailable since the user will not have the opportunity to enter a subaddress.
